Integrating AI in Agriculture for Enhanced Crop Yields

Discover how AI transforms agriculture through data collection predictive modeling optimization and project management for enhanced crop yields and resource efficiency

Category: AI for Development Project Management

Industry: Agriculture

Introduction

This workflow outlines the integration of artificial intelligence in agriculture, focusing on data collection, predictive modeling, optimization, project management, and continuous improvement. By leveraging advanced technologies, farmers can enhance decision-making processes, optimize resource utilization, and ultimately improve crop yields.

Data Collection and Preprocessing

  1. Deploy IoT sensors across fields to collect real-time data on:
    • Soil moisture, temperature, and nutrient levels
    • Weather conditions (temperature, rainfall, humidity)
    • Crop growth metrics
  2. Gather historical yield data, satellite imagery, and regional climate records.
  3. Utilize computer vision AI to analyze drone and satellite imagery to detect crop health issues.
  4. Clean and standardize data from multiple sources using AI data preprocessing tools.

Predictive Modeling

  1. Develop machine learning models (e.g., Random Forests, Gradient Boosting) to predict yields based on the collected data.
  2. Implement deep learning models such as LSTMs to capture temporal dependencies in time-series data.
  3. Employ ensemble methods to combine predictions from multiple models for enhanced accuracy.
  4. Leverage explainable AI techniques like SHAP to interpret model predictions.

Optimization and Decision Support

  1. Utilize AI-powered optimization algorithms to determine optimal:
    • Planting dates and crop varieties
    • Irrigation schedules
    • Fertilizer and pesticide application plans
  2. Generate AI-driven recommendations for farmers through a user-friendly dashboard.
  3. Implement reinforcement learning agents to continuously enhance recommendations based on outcomes.

Project Management Integration

  1. Utilize AI project management tools to:
    • Automatically generate and assign tasks based on predictions and recommendations
    • Track progress and identify potential delays or issues
    • Optimize resource allocation across multiple farming projects
  2. Implement natural language processing to extract insights from project documentation and communications.
  3. Utilize predictive analytics to forecast project timelines and resource needs.

Continuous Improvement

  1. Collect feedback and actual yield data to evaluate model performance.
  2. Retrain models regularly with new data to enhance accuracy over time.
  3. Utilize AI to identify areas for process improvement and suggest workflow optimizations.

AI Tools for Integration

  • Computer vision for crop monitoring: Tools like PlantCV or DeepAg
  • Predictive modeling: Scikit-learn, TensorFlow, or H2O.ai
  • Optimization: Tools like IBM Decision Optimization or Google OR-Tools
  • Explainable AI: SHAP or LIME
  • Project management: AI-enhanced tools like Forecast or Clarizen

By integrating AI throughout this workflow, agricultural projects can benefit from more accurate predictions, optimized decision-making, and streamlined management processes. The AI-driven approach enables dynamic adjustments based on real-time data and changing conditions, leading to improved crop yields and more efficient resource utilization.

Keyword: AI crop yield optimization techniques

Scroll to Top